A big part of the problem is labelling. Some yes, some no, but when I see "check local recycling" on a plastic thing it is really annoying.

When you buy something, one is naturally interested in the contents, and not necessarily concerned about the packaging disposal, at the time of purchase. Having a minimum % (eg 10%) of the front of the package, in a standardised form,  clearly showing how recyclable it is would, I think, provide consumers useful and helpful information when deciding what to decide to buy.

I can see something a bit like the traffic light system for food: Red % - not recyclable like films and film lined coffee cups, Orange - some local authorities recycle this like more obcsure plastics, Green - Universally recycled - glass, tins, cardboard universally recycled plastics.

Hopefully this would encourage manufacturers into only using the more universally recycled stuff in the first place, making life easier for all of us!
